Otto Porter Jr. drops 33 as Georgetown tops Syracuse
February 24, 2013 at 2:21 AM by AHN · Leave a Comment
Syracuse, NY, United States (4E Sports) – Otto Porter Jr. recorded 33 points and 8 rebounds to power the Georgetown Hoyas to a 57-46 victory over the Syracuse Orange, 57-46, Saturday at Carrier Dome.
The Hoyas posted their ninth straight victory and 11th win of their last 12 games behind a remarkable performance from their leading scorer.
Porter Jr, averaging a team-high 15.1 points and 7.7 rebounds, sliced through the Orange defense like a hot knife on a butter, sparking a big second half for the Hoyas.
After a low scoring first half, the Hoyas elevated their play a notch higher with tight defense and better shot selection.
Both teams shot below 36 percent from the field, but the Hoyas defense forced the Orange to commit 16 of the 27 turnovers in the game.
C.J. Fair racked up 13 points and 7 rebounds while James Southerland recorded 13 points and 7 rebounds off the bench for Syracuse, which dropped to 22-5 (10-4 in Big East).
Georgetown improved to 21-4 (11-3 in Big East) and is set to take on the upset-minded UConn Huskies on February 27.
